资源包含了基于等距模型的鱼眼图像校正算法的Matlab实现,同时代码中给出了Matlab实现的线性插值和双线性插值。下载后添加图片直接运行即可。(适当调节rows1,cols1的数值,改变映射图像的效果,最好效果建议rows1=rows;cols1=cols)
2021-08-13 15:28:05 2KB 鱼眼,校正
1
鱼眼矫正 常见的鱼眼矫正算法 棋盘格矫正法 经纬度矫正法 鱼眼图示例 棋盘格矫正法 利用棋盘格进行标定, 然后计算鱼眼镜头的畸变系数以及内参, opencv中自带有fisheye模块, 可以直接根据棋盘格标定结果,采用cv2.fisheye.calibrate计算畸变系数以及内参, 然后使用cv2.fisheye.initUndistortRectifyMap函数计算映射矩阵, 最后根据映射矩阵, 使用cv2.remap进行矫正。 矫正结果如下: 棋盘格矫正法的效果并不好, 而且边缘效果较差, 拉伸比较严重。 参考代码: 经纬度矫正法 经纬度矫正法, 可以把鱼眼图想象成半个地球, 然后将地球展开成地图,经纬度矫正法主要是利用几何原理, 对图像进行展开矫正, 基于经纬度矫正法进行改进的矫正的算法也很多, 下面主要介绍的是双径度矫正法, 具体的原理参考论文《基于双经度模型的鱼眼图像畸变矫正方法
2021-06-12 22:51:11 6.63MB 附件源码 文章源码
1
该文档详细介绍鱼眼图像的矫正与拼接,可以作为相关研究人员的参考。
2021-05-25 09:45:43 187KB 鱼眼 校正  拼接
1
对于球面鱼眼镜头有很大的校正效果,绝对可靠,已经验证过,内附matlab代码,检查标定代码。学习研究很有必要
2021-05-12 09:56:32 3.14MB 鱼眼图像校正
1
全景图像一般可以使用视角较宽的相机或者全景相机进行拍摄获取,然后再把不同视角拍摄的图像进行拼接就可以得到全方位的图像。广角相机可以得到视角非常大的图像,但是图像分辨率较低,并且广角相机存在边界效应-图像边界位置会产生变形。而鱼眼相机视野更广,而且价格便宜,经常用来进行360全景图像的获取。然而获取的鱼眼图像虽然视觉广,但是不同视角和位置拍摄的图像由于产生了形变,无法直接拼接而得到全景图像,因此需要对鱼眼图像展开,然后不同角度的图像进行一定的特征匹配,找到不同图像中匹配的点,再把图像进行形变,使得不同的图像可以拼接起来。
2021-04-30 23:15:46 63.37MB 鱼眼图像 经纬度矫 图像拼接 matlab
1
基于双经度模型的鱼眼图像畸变矫正方法_魏利胜
2021-04-25 15:41:24 505KB 双经度模型
1
在OpenCV3.41 vs2017环境下编译运行,摄像机标定,能够对鱼眼镜头进行畸变矫正,但效果感觉不是特别好,希望能改进吧
2021-04-23 12:55:45 43.98MB 摄像机标 畸变矫
1
使用MATLAB实现鱼眼图片亮度曲线的绘制,可以自己选择某一径向,最终得到的是从圆心到边缘的亮度曲线
2021-03-31 20:03:04 564B MATLAB 鱼眼图像 亮度曲线
1
《基于双经度模型的鱼眼图像畸变矫正方法_魏利胜》,依据这篇文章所写的MATLAB双经度的鱼眼图像畸变校正,能够对大视场角的鱼眼镜头图像进行畸变矫正,可以参考一下,利用鱼眼成像的等距模型
2021-03-28 15:44:52 1KB 双经度 鱼眼图像 畸变校正
1
为消除鱼眼镜头带来的形变,本文提出一种应用经纬映射的鱼眼图像校正方法,推导了消除变形的数学依据,总结出一种不需要任何标定数据,快速的纠正等角鱼眼变形的算法。
2021-02-21 08:53:58 241KB 鱼眼图像 校正 经纬映射
1